In my game, I can use the same armor models on all the races because I'm using the human default with all variables set a specific uniform way. In Unreal Engine, I scale the character's XYZ to create the short dwarves, the giant Ogres, the skinny Elves, etc.

So really all the variation is in the face.

Another thing I would like, if maybe lizard faces is too hard, would be simple bat and/or bird style wings. They don't need to flap or anything, I don't want flying in my game. But on a jump, I'll animate them so that they spread out and slow the character's fall. If we can coordinate things properly, using as few bones as possible, we might be able to use APEX CLOTH on the wings to get super realistic leathery bat wings! Also, there are feather/hair textures we can experiment with to make realistic bird wings!

Something that happens when I try to import APEX Cloth that I haven't gotten around yet is that it needs to have no more than FOUR bones influencing any individual vertex. So if you can make each wing out of four bones (might be tough for bat but we could do each "vein" as a bone), then the wing material itself doesn't even need to be there!

So bat wing bones with a cool model/texture for the "bone" part, and I'll fill in the wings later!

Bird wings would be a whole other process, I think ;)
